アバランチ(AVAX)スケーラビリティ問題を解決!



アバランチ(AVAX)スケーラビリティ問題を解決!


アバランチ(AVAX)スケーラビリティ問題を解決!

アバランチ(Avalanche、AVAX)は、その高速なトランザクション処理能力と低い手数料で注目を集めているブロックチェーンプラットフォームです。しかし、急速な成長に伴い、スケーラビリティ問題が顕在化しつつあります。本稿では、アバランチのスケーラビリティ問題の詳細な分析、その原因、そして解決策について、技術的な側面から深く掘り下げて解説します。

1. アバランチのアーキテクチャとスケーラビリティ

アバランチは、従来のブロックチェーンとは異なる独自のアーキテクチャを採用しています。具体的には、以下の3つのブロックチェーンが組み合わさって構成されています。

  • P-Chain (Platform Chain): アバランチネットワーク全体の管理、バリデーターの追跡、サブネットの作成を担います。
  • X-Chain (Exchange Chain): AVAXトークンやその他のデジタル資産の作成と取引に使用されます。
  • C-Chain (Contract Chain): スマートコントラクトの実行環境を提供し、Ethereum Virtual Machine (EVM) と互換性があります。

このアーキテクチャは、高いスループットと柔軟性をもたらしますが、同時にスケーラビリティのボトルネックを生み出す可能性も秘めています。特に、C-Chainにおけるスマートコントラクトの実行は、ネットワーク全体のトランザクション処理能力に影響を与えます。

2. スケーラビリティ問題の現状

アバランチネットワークのトランザクション数は、着実に増加しています。しかし、トランザクション数の増加に伴い、以下の問題が顕在化しています。

  • トランザクション遅延の増加: トランザクションの承認に時間がかかるようになり、ユーザーエクスペリエンスを低下させています。
  • ガス代の高騰: スマートコントラクトの実行に必要なガス代が高騰し、小規模なトランザクションの実行コストが増加しています。
  • ネットワークの混雑: トランザクションの処理が追いつかず、ネットワークが混雑し、正常な動作が困難になる場合があります。

これらの問題は、アバランチの普及を阻害する要因となり得ます。特に、DeFi(分散型金融)アプリケーションの利用者は、高速かつ低コストなトランザクションを求めているため、スケーラビリティ問題は深刻な影響を与えます。

3. スケーラビリティ問題の原因分析

アバランチのスケーラビリティ問題の原因は、多岐にわたります。主な原因としては、以下の点が挙げられます。

  • コンセンサスアルゴリズムの制約: アバランチは、Avalancheコンセンサスという独自のコンセンサスアルゴリズムを採用しています。このアルゴリズムは、高いスループットとセキュリティを実現しますが、同時にトランザクションの処理能力には限界があります。
  • C-ChainのEVM互換性: C-Chainは、EVMと互換性があるため、Ethereumの既存のアプリケーションを容易に移植できます。しかし、EVMは、トランザクションの処理効率が低いという欠点があります。
  • サブネットの設計: アバランチのサブネットは、特定のアプリケーションやユースケースに特化したブロックチェーンを作成できます。しかし、サブネットの設計が不適切である場合、ネットワーク全体のパフォーマンスに悪影響を与える可能性があります。
  • ネットワークのインフラストラクチャ: アバランチネットワークのノード数やネットワーク帯域幅が不足している場合、トランザクションの処理能力が制限されます。

4. スケーラビリティ問題を解決するための技術的アプローチ

アバランチのスケーラビリティ問題を解決するためには、様々な技術的アプローチが考えられます。以下に、主な解決策をいくつか紹介します。

4.1. レイヤー2ソリューションの導入

レイヤー2ソリューションは、アバランチのメインチェーン(P-Chain、X-Chain、C-Chain)の負荷を軽減し、トランザクション処理能力を向上させるための技術です。代表的なレイヤー2ソリューションとしては、以下のものが挙げられます。

  • State Channels: 2者間のトランザクションをオフチェーンで処理し、最終的な結果のみをメインチェーンに記録します。
  • Sidechains: メインチェーンとは独立したブロックチェーンを作成し、トランザクションをオフチェーンで処理します。
  • Rollups: 複数のトランザクションをまとめて1つのトランザクションとしてメインチェーンに記録します。

これらのレイヤー2ソリューションを導入することで、アバランチネットワークのトランザクション処理能力を大幅に向上させることができます。

4.2. シャーディング技術の導入

シャーディング技術は、ブロックチェーンネットワークを複数のシャード(断片)に分割し、各シャードが独立してトランザクションを処理する技術です。これにより、ネットワーク全体のトランザクション処理能力を向上させることができます。アバランチは、将来的にシャーディング技術を導入することを検討しています。

4.3. コンセンサスアルゴリズムの改良

Avalancheコンセンサスアルゴリズムを改良することで、トランザクションの処理効率を向上させることができます。具体的には、コンセンサスプロトコルの最適化や、新しいコンセンサスアルゴリズムの導入などが考えられます。

4.4. サブネットの最適化

サブネットの設計を最適化することで、ネットワーク全体のパフォーマンスを向上させることができます。具体的には、サブネットのノード数やネットワーク帯域幅の調整、サブネット間の通信プロトコルの最適化などが考えられます。

4.5. ネットワークインフラストラクチャの強化

アバランチネットワークのノード数を増やし、ネットワーク帯域幅を強化することで、トランザクションの処理能力を向上させることができます。また、ノードの地理的な分散を促進することで、ネットワークの信頼性を高めることができます。

5. アバランチのスケーラビリティ問題に対する今後の展望

アバランチチームは、スケーラビリティ問題の解決に向けて、積極的に取り組んでいます。上記の技術的アプローチに加え、コミュニティとの連携を強化し、様々なアイデアを収集・検討しています。また、アバランチネットワークのモニタリングを強化し、問題の早期発見と迅速な対応に努めています。

アバランチのスケーラビリティ問題は、ブロックチェーン技術が直面する共通の課題です。しかし、アバランチの革新的なアーキテクチャと活発なコミュニティは、この課題を克服し、よりスケーラブルで効率的なブロックチェーンプラットフォームを実現する可能性を秘めています。

6. まとめ

アバランチ(AVAX)は、その優れた技術力と柔軟性により、ブロックチェーン業界において重要な役割を担っています。しかし、急速な成長に伴い、スケーラビリティ問題が顕在化しています。本稿では、アバランチのスケーラビリティ問題の詳細な分析、その原因、そして解決策について解説しました。レイヤー2ソリューションの導入、シャーディング技術の導入、コンセンサスアルゴリズムの改良、サブネットの最適化、ネットワークインフラストラクチャの強化など、様々な技術的アプローチが考えられます。アバランチチームは、これらの解決策を積極的に推進し、よりスケーラブルで効率的なブロックチェーンプラットフォームの実現を目指しています。今後のアバランチの発展に期待しましょう。


前の記事

コインチェックの取引履歴で損益計算を簡単に行う方法ガイド

次の記事

ビットバンクの新機能アップデート情報をタイムリーに紹介

コメントを書く

Leave a Comment

メールアドレスが公開されることはありません。 が付いている欄は必須項目です